Mums of Steel Stroller Strength Fitness
FREE CLASSES
Jump start weight loss, fight the baby blues, meet other mums, bond with baby and have fun!
All exercise programmes are developed specifically for the post-natal mother including a focus on stomach toning. During the class you will burn calories and fat through a cardio session and improve posture and muscle tone by resistance and core work.
There is no need to find a crèche or someone to look after your baby, as they are integral to the programme.

Outdoor Gyms
for everyday active adults
Just for adults, these brand new gyms offer you the opportunity to have fun exercising, whilst enjoying the fresh air of the outdoors. There are seven items of equipment, offering a range of exercise opportunities, including toning of the upper and lower body and fitness to the heart and lungs.
Three Rivers District Council are pleased to introduce three sites, located at Leavseden Country Park, Abbots Langley, Barton Way play area, Croxley Green and Ebury Play Area, Rickmansworth. Health walks in Three Rivers
This health walking scheme is coordinated by The Countryside Management Service (CMS) and is a countywide programme of free, led walks. It aims to help promote walking and encourage more people (all ages, backgrounds and abilities) to get outdoors, get more active and reap the benefits.
